Auditions for Ruddigore will be held in room W20-491 (84 Masschusetts Avenue, MIT Student Center).
If callbacks are held, they will take place on Saturday, September 6th, 2003, 2-5 pm in W20-407.
Special Note: If you are interested in the parts of Robin, Despard or Mad Margaret, the directors may ask you to demonstrate patter skills.
Sing Through (first rehearsal): Sunday, September 7th, 2-5 pm (location to be announced).
No appointment is necessary — simply come to either audition period. Auditions will be in first-come, first-seen order.
Please bring two copies of sheet music of a prepared song in English (one for the accompanist; one for you). A brief theatrical resume is optional.
Don't have a song? Sing "Happy Birthday" or "Twinkle, Twinkle Little Star."
The director will provide a scene to be acted at the auditions.
